Suwannee County Coordinator Johnny Wooley was fired Tuesday night by a 3-2 vote of the county commission. The motion to fire Wooley was made by newly elected District 5 commissioner Wesley Wainwright, who was sworn in earlier that day.
Commissioners Douglas Udell and Billy Maxwell voted to keep Wooley.
Udell questioned the need to fire Wooley, asking Wainwright who he was indebted to politically to make such a move. Wainwright said he simply acted on the wishes of those in his district who said they are not happy with the direction the county has been going in recent years. Maxwell said he saw no reason to fire Wooley, since Wainwright gave no reason for doing so.
